Pendegast Surname Meaning

From Where Does The Surname Originate? meaning and history

Seems to be a compound of pend- (seen in the name of the famous 7th-cent. Mercian King Penda), and Teutonic gast (Old Saxon, O.H.Ger., O.Dut. gast = Goth, gast-s = Old English gest, gi(e)st = Old Norse gest-r), guest, stranger. (In purely A.- Saxon names the form of the second element was usually -gist, as in the case of the Friþegist mentioned in the Chronicle, A D. 993).

If Pend- is Teutonic it must be the same word as Old Frisian pend, pand = East Frisian pand = M.L.Ger. and Dutch pand = Old Norse pant-r (m.) = Ger. pfand, a pledge (Old Frisian penda = Ger. pfänden); but there are reasonable grounds for assuming that the stem is Celtic (cp. Chad), viz. the O.Cymric pend (Welsh pen, Cornish pe(d)n) = Old Irish cend (Irish and Gaelic ceann), head, chief.

Surnames of the United Kingdom (1912) by Henry Harrison

How Common Is The Last Name Pendegast? popularity and diffusion

The last name Pendegast is the 5,057,639th most commonly used surname world-wide, borne by approximately 1 in 485,836,394 people. The last name occurs mostly in Europe, where 67 percent of Pendegast live; 67 percent live in Northern Europe and 40 percent live in British Isles.

The surname Pendegast is most widely held in England, where it is borne by 6 people, or 1 in 9,286,343. In England Pendegast is mostly found in: East Riding of Yorkshire, where 100 percent are found. Outside of England it is found in 3 countries. It is also found in Denmark, where 27 percent are found and The United States, where 20 percent are found.

Pendegast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The occurrence of Pendegast has changed through the years. In England the number of people who held the Pendegast last name declined 62 percent between 1881 and 2014 and in The United States it declined 98 percent between 1880 and 2014.
